Five House Seats Move Towards Democrats

July 13, 2018 at 10:37 am EDT By Taegan Goddard Leave a Comment

The Cook Political Report‘s latest house ratings show three more Republican-held seats moving towards the Democrats:

  • FL-6 moves from Solid Republican to Likely Republican
  • FL-16 moves from Likely Republican to Lean Republican
  • IL-13 moves from Likely Republican to Lean Republican
  • ME-2 moves from Lean Republican to Toss Up
  • MI-8 moves from Lean Republican to Toss Up

David Wasserman: “If the 26 Toss Ups break evenly, Dems would net 19 seats, 4 short of majority. But if the 60 competitive seats (Lean/Toss Up) break evenly, Dems would net 28 seats, 5 more than they need.”

Trump’s Dubious Claims of Success

July 13, 2018 at 10:31 am EDT By Taegan Goddard Leave a Comment

“Declaring victory over freeloading partners, President Trump claimed he had secured significant new concessions from NATO member nations on military spending after days of public haranguing. But even before Air Force One completed its 50-minute flight across the English Channel to the next stop on his European tour, Trump’s claims of accomplishment were challenged by the same allies he claimed had caved,” the AP reports.

“Trump’s head-spinning 28 hours at the NATO summit in Brussels before visiting Britain reaffirmed a familiar pattern for the salesman-turned-president, who left a chaotic trail behind and whose self-proclaimed accomplishments abroad proved once again to be more show than substance. In the space of eight hours, Trump had moved from doubting the utility of the mutual defense alliance and provoking an extraordinary emergency session of its members to declaring the pact stronger than ever.”

“It’s a playbook Trump has followed before: Trump claimed world-altering success following last month’s meeting with Kim Jong Un, when he stated that North Korea was ‘no longer a nuclear threat’ after their historic summit in Singapore. And in May, he took a victory lap on a supposed trade deal with China, only to see it morph into the beginnings of a trade war.”

Secret Money Funds 40% of Outside Congressional Ads

July 13, 2018 at 9:27 am EDT By Taegan Goddard Leave a Comment

“Secret donors financed more than four out of every 10 television ads that outside groups broadcast this year to influence November’s high-stakes congressional elections,” according to a USA Today analysis.

“Leading the way: organizations affiliated with billionaire industrialist Charles Koch, whose conservative donor network plows hundreds of millions of dollars into politics and policy debates each election cycle.”

Trade Talks with China Have ‘Broken Down’

July 13, 2018 at 7:17 am EDT By Taegan Goddard Leave a Comment

New York Times: “The trade war between the United States and China showed no signs of yielding on Thursday, as Steven Mnuchin, the Treasury secretary, told lawmakers there was no clear path to resolution and Beijing blasted the administration over its approach. Mr. Mnuchin, who has tried to avoid calling the trade tensions with China a ‘war,’ said talks with Beijing had ‘broken down’ and suggested it was now up to China to come to the table with concessions.”

“The Chinese, meanwhile, accused the United States of ‘acting erratically’ and said the administration had ‘blatantly abandoned the consensuses that two sides have reached and insisted on fighting a trade war with China.’”

Kushner Still Lacks Top Secret Security Clearance

July 13, 2018 at 7:01 am EDT By Taegan Goddard Leave a Comment

Washington Post: “Jared Kushner, a senior White House adviser and President Trump’s son-in-law, lacks the security clearance level required to review some of the government’s most sensitive secrets, according to two people familiar with his access. For the first year of the Trump administration, Kushner had nearly blanket access to highly classified intelligence, even as he held an interim security clearance and awaited the completion of his background investigation.”

“But when White House security officials granted him a permanent clearance in late May, he was granted only ‘top secret’ status — a level that does not allow him to see some of the country’s most closely guarded intelligence.”
